This picture shows a really gorgeous alpine meadow, as seen from the trail, with Mount Cedric Wright in
the background. The far edge of the meadow drops off steeply down to Twin Lakes, one of our campsites
from last Summer. This kind of meadow is very spongey and deep, and you can just about sense that from
the way it looks.
